Column 339
Sky Sports darts walk-on girl – Nicola Elisa Moriarty

The Professional Darts Corporation (PDC) World Championship begins this weekend at Alexandra Palace so it’s time to get to know the players or, in the case of Dartoid’s World, to get to know the one person the players would most like to play with. Of course, that individual is Sky Sports walk-on girl extraordinaire, Nicola Moriarty.

For several nights running Moriarty and I (who lie) have dined over wine in a quaint little restaurant in fashionable Soho. So I have the poop. Here’s a snapshot:

Okay, here’s a better snapshot:

I suppose it’s fitting that Moriarty is from Chester. But what’s truly bizarre that when you anagram her name (and subtract and add a few letters) it spells “Dartoid is HUNG.” Go figure.

It should come as no surprise that after graduating from St. Chad’s High School in Runcorn, a short career in sales and an even shorter stint (two hours) standing in front of a conveyor belt and picking out rogue peanuts, the 34-25-36 hazel-eyed knockout shifted her focus (and the gaze of the lads) to beauty pageants and modeling.

On the pageant circuit and against some serious babes Moriarty’s reeled off a string of wins damn near as long and impressive as Phil Taylor’s resume. Among her long list of titles: Miss British Isles, Miss Berdbury Hall, Miss Hawaiian Tropic International, Miss Intercontinental Wales, Miss Halton Vale and Miss Chester – and she was a finalist in Miss Hawaiian Tropic Great Britain and Miss Great Britain competitions. She’s also come out tops (note the darts pun) as Merryside Model of the Year, Northwest Model of the Year and was selected Top Model of the World Delegate for Great Britain.

It was through her agency, Angels Elite (www.angelselite.co.uk), run by Sue Knight and Karen Jean Cookson (the two original darts walk-on girls – who worked the first-ever walk-on when Larry Butler shocked Dennis Priestley at the 1994 PCD World Matchplay) that Moriarty landed key modelling contracts with Honda Hydrex (as the BSB Super Girl), TJ Hughes Commercial, and her current claim to fame: her role as a walk-on girl for Sky Sports. She also models for Bentley, which is some sort of car as well as my dog’s name (and I guess also the name of one of her goldfish), and just a month ago was chosen as the Real Bond Girl to launch the new Daniel Craig waxwork at Tussaud’s in Blackpool.

She’s even done a bit of acting including a must-see promotional clip reenacting Meg Ryan’s role in the Katz’s Delicatessen scene from Harry met Sally.

So Moriarty is making her mark and is understandably quite pleased, especially with her Sky Sports contract. “Naturally I was over the moon because, as most people close to me will tell you, I am a big darts fan!”

She’s been a league player since her teenage years and is a frequent (and popular) participant at the world’s premier Internet darts forum, Superstars of Darts, giving as well as she gets amidst the sometimes rough and tumble camaraderie.
